From the 1st September.
Introduction
A referral to review the safety card and request that baggage be left behind in an emergency situation has been added to the 10 and 20 Minutes to Landing Announcements for all flights from all bases to achieve compliance with new regulatory requirements. In addition, reference has also been made to alert customers to the change in requirement for window blinds to be returned to the open/clear position for landing.

If you are seated by a window and have lowered the blind please return this to the open position for landing.
